Als Makro korrekt als Private Sub falsch?
07.02.2019 18:58:53
David
ich habe folgendes Makro:
Sub ResetCommets2()
Dim ct As Integer, ht As Integer
Dim cmt As Comment
For Each cmt In ActiveSheet.Comments
ct = cmt.Shape.TextFrame.Characters.Count
cmt.Shape.Top = cmt.Parent.Top + 5
cmt.Shape.Left = _
cmt.Parent.Offset(0, 1).Left + 5
cmt.Shape.Width = 100
If ct = 30 And ct
wenn ich dieses Makro permanet ausführen will als SelectionChange funktioniert er nicht mehr?Woran kann es liegen?
Private Sub Worksheet_SelectionChange(ByVal Target As Excel.Range)
Dim ct As Integer, ht As Integer
Dim cmt As Comment
For Each cmt In ActiveSheet.Comments
ct = cmt.Shape.TextFrame.Characters.Count
cmt.Shape.Top = cmt.Parent.Top + 5
cmt.Shape.Left = _
cmt.Parent.Offset(0, 1).Left + 5
cmt.Shape.Width = 100
If ct = 30 And ct
Vielen Dank schonmal.
LG David